Russell Mason

Russell Mason

Russell is a Principal and Worldwide Partner of Mercer, National Business Leader for Industry/Multi-Employer Superannuation and Asia Pacific Leader for Defined Contribution Consulting. After completing an Arts/Law degree at Macquarie University, Russell practiced as a solicitor prior to entering the superannuation industry.

 

Since joining Mercer in 1987 Russell has worked in all aspects of superannuation, with both corporate, industry and multi-employer superannuation funds. He has been involved in advising both Australian and multi-national corporations in the areas of benefit design, strategy, insurance, investments and compliance.  As National Business Leader for Industry/Multi-Employer Superannuation, Russell has specifically advised industry funds on administration arrangements, competitive structures and strategic directions. In dealing with these funds Russell has also developed an extensive knowledge of industrial relations practice and procedures.

 

Russell is a Director of the Board of the Association of Superannuation Funds of Australia, the peak body in Australia representating the superannuation industry. Russell is also a member of the Editorial Board of Superfunds magazine, a member of the NSW Executive and National Conference Committee; and a former Chair of the NSW Executive of ASFA.

 


Brent Tulk

Brent Tulk

Brent Tulk is a Principal of the retirement practice of Mercer. Brent's role at Mercer includes consulting to corporates, corporate superannuation funds and industry funds in relation to superannuation strategies, benefit design, legislative compliance and project management. He also performs fund secretarial duties and has experience in actuarial matters including actuarial reviews and accounting disclosures.

 

Brent has been working in the superannuation industry for 9 years, and has been working with Mercer since 1997. Previously Brent has worked as a practicing lawyer with a commercial law firm.

 

Brent holds a Bachelor of Economics Degree and Bachelor of Law Degree.

 


Martin Horan

Martin Horan

Martin joined Mercer in 2005, at the time of Mercer’s acquisition of the Mellon business in Australia and has headed the Mercer Legal consulting practice nationally since July 2007.  Martin had previously managed the legal consulting practice within Mellon and predecessor companies. Martin’s background is in commercial law and for the last 15 years he has practised mainly in the areas of financial services and employee benefits. His clients include trustees of superannuation and pension funds, their sponsoring employers and financial institutions. He advises some of Australia’s largest financial institutions and funds in areas such as mergers and product development, general governance and compliance and fiduciary obligations under trust law. Martin acted for several years as Chairman of Directors of Mercer Benefit Nominees Limited (previously Mellon Nominees Limited), a company that acted as trustee of a range of public offer, corporate and industry superannuation funds.

 

Martin is a regular presenter at client and financial services industry forums and conferences, including the Law Council of Australia’s Superannuation Law Conference in February 2007, where he presented on recent developments in relevant Australian case law.

 


Simon Eagleton

Simon Eagleton

Simon Eagleton is the Business Leader for Mercer’s investment consulting business in Australia and New Zealand. He is based in Mercer’s Sydney office.

 

Simon advises Australian clients on all aspects of their investment programs. His particular areas of expertise are asset-liability modelling and strategy development. Simon is also a member of Mercer Investment Consulting’s Australian Investment Policy Committee, responsible for establishing Mercer’s house policy on investment strategy and manager configuration issues.

 

Simon holds a Bachelor of Economics degree from the Australian National University and is a Fellow of the Institute of Actuaries of Australia.

 


Darren Wickham

Darren Wickham

Darren Wickham is an Actuary and Principal in Mercer’s retirement practice and joined as a result of the acquisition of Mellon, where he was Head of Superannuation Consulting for NSW.

 

Darren has worked in superannuation and life insurance for more than 13 years and has specialised in valuing employee benefits including superannuation, executive options and other entitlements. He was recently the Editor of the actuarial profession’s magazine - Actuary Australia and was Chief Examiner for the Institute of Actuaries professional examination in Superannuation. He has sat (and is sitting) on several Institute committees including Retirement Incomes Taskforce, Employee Entitlements and Accounts & Investments. More recently, Darren is a member of the Institute’s Super Tax Reform Task Force and has constructed a comprehensive model of tax revenue from and growth of assets in Australia’s superannuation system. He has written various papers on superannuation and employee benefit related matters.

 

Darren has a Masters in Economics (Actuarial Major) from Macquarie University and is a Fellow of the Institute of Actuaries of Australia.

 


Kathryn Daniels

Kathryn Daniels

Kathryn is a member of the actuarial team in our Adelaide office and acts as actuary to a number of the Adelaide, Perth and Sydney defined benefit funds.

 

She has been with Mercer since March 2004, prior to which she was employed by Watson Wyatt in Melbourne for 7 years. At Watson Wyatt, Kathryn worked in a support consultant role and was actuary to defined benefit funds. Kathryn is a bright, energetic actuary, who in her time with Mercer has demonstrated her ability to work closely with clients, along with attention to detail, which makes her ideal for a client relationship and project management role.

 

She has a Bachelor of Science (in Mathematical and Computer Science) Degree from The University of Adelaide and has been a Fellow of the Institute of Actuaries of Australia since 2002.
